How We Started

Four years ago, we noticed a gap between fashion industry developments and accessible education. Most content was either too superficial for serious learners or locked behind industry paywalls.

We built Raskido to bridge that gap. Our first webinar in March 2021 covered fabric innovation in sustainable collections. Twelve people attended. They asked questions about fiber composition, production methods, and actual cost structures.

That level of specific inquiry shaped everything that followed. We realized people wanted technical depth presented clearly, not simplified to the point of uselessness.

Our Lead Strategist

Every webinar reflects expertise built through years of hands-on work with designers, manufacturers, and retailers across multiple markets.

Viktor Sokolov, Lead Fashion Strategist

Viktor Sokolov

Lead Fashion Strategist

Viktor spent eight years working between design studios and production facilities, analyzing why some collections succeed commercially while technically similar ones fail. He tracks pattern adoption rates, seasonal color performance, and retail markdown patterns across Eastern European markets.

His webinars focus on the mechanics: how fabric choices affect production costs, why certain silhouettes appear season after season, and what early indicators suggest emerging trends versus passing fads.
